Guia CNC Brasil - Tudo sobre CNC, Router, Laser, Torno e 3D Print

SOFTWARES => Software CAM - Geral => Art-Cam => Tópico iniciado por: Bruxo em 14 de Abril de 2011, 20:31

Título: Troca de Ferramenta
Enviado por: Bruxo em 14 de Abril de 2011, 20:31
 Ola pessoal, sei que ja estou abussando,,,,,  rs,rs,   mas preciso da ajuda de vcs ok!!, lógico se alguem poder me ajudar e se realmente eu não esteja falando uma puta besteira rs,rs,,,vamos la,,
 quando tentei criar um percuso de desbaste,, e depois o acabamento  no Art cam,,, mudando a ferramenta claro rs,rs, simplesmente o artcam,  não aceita troca de ferramenta,,,,, alguem sabe como fazer isso? sabe como burlar o art cam? sabe algum macete que possa me ajudar?? desde ja agradeço..
abçs,, Bruxo
Título: Re:Troca de Ferramenta
Enviado por: Alebe em 14 de Abril de 2011, 20:54
Bruxo,
O artcam aceita troca sim.
Mas vc deve usar um posprocessador que aceite a troca, pois não são todos que estão configurados para isso.
E precisa tambem mudar o nº da ferramenta na aba de configuração do percurso, pois todas estão como nº 1.
Título: Re:Troca de Ferramenta
Enviado por: Alebe em 14 de Abril de 2011, 21:00
Complementando.
O pos deve ter uma seção como essa:

; Toolchange Sections
;
TOOLCHANGE = "M9"
TOOLCHANGE = "G0Z50.0000"
TOOLCHANGE = "M5"
TOOLCHANGE = "T2"
TOOLCHANGE = "M6"
TOOLCHANGE = "M3 "
TOOLCHANGE = "M7"
TOOLCHANGE = "M8"
TOOLCHANGE = "F360"
;

Ela deve ficar antes da seção "End of file"

A parte em vermelho é a altura que vc quer que o eixo z vá para facilitar a troca.

Agora uma pergunta Off para quem puder me explicar sobre html.
Se o texto que digito conter o [ S ]sem espaços entre os caracteres, as próximas palavras ficam todas cortadas.
O que fazer para isto não ocorrer?
Neste código, logo depois de M3 tem exatamente estes caracteres e ele é reconhecido como codigo fonte e não aparece na mensagem.
Título: Re:Troca de Ferramenta
Enviado por: Bruxo em 14 de Abril de 2011, 21:46
grande Alebe,,  brigaduuuuuuu,,,,, valeu mesmo!! mas olha,,,,, no artcam  quando coloco,,, mudo o numero da ferramenta, simplesmente  quando tento gerar o percuso,,ja  da  o erro,, sei la!! posso ta fazendo algo errado,,,,,,, mas não aceita outra ferramamenta mesmo,, Estou usando o pos processador do grande mestre Lolata,,,,, essas linhas que vc postou,,, tenho que acrescentar no pós?? PS: o erro pode ta sendo meu ok!!,, mas,, quanto a sua duvida,,  quando,, vc digita o texto,,, veja, se seu teclado esta configurado com ABNT2 ok,,,,,,, se não estiver,,,,  configure p/ isso, ok!!  qq duvida,,,, me da um help, nisso consigo te ajudar rs,rs,,, isso acontece muito rs,rs,  abçs bruxo
Título: Re:Troca de Ferramenta
Enviado por: Alebe em 14 de Abril de 2011, 22:12
Esse erro pode ser por outro motivo, tipo tentar criar percurso interno com ferramenta com diametro maior que o espaço entre vetores.

Vá na pasta de pos do artcam e abra o pos que usa no editor de texto ou notepad.
Verifique se tem esta seção de troca de ferramentas.
Que eu me lembre, o pos do Lolata não tinha tinha essa seção não. Confere aí.

-----

O problema não é configuração de teclado.
Tem a ver com códigos html.
Faça um teste e tente acresentar colchete+S+colchete (sem o sinal de + e sem espaços) na mensagem.
Ela é tratada como codigo de pg e não aparece na mensagem e deixa todas os caracteres seguintes riscadas.
E naquela seção do posprocessador, esse sinal é responsavel pela velocidade de rotação do spindle.
Teste:
Fica tudo riscado... hehehehe
Título: Re:Troca de Ferramenta
Enviado por: Bruxo em 15 de Abril de 2011, 19:16
Alebe!! mil desculpas, entendi sua msg totalmente errada,,,,,  por isso disse que podia ser configuração do teclado!!, mas em fim,, verifiquei o pós do Mestre Lolata, e nã tem essas linhas que vc postou,,,,,  sendo assim,, devo acrescentar essas linhas exatamente como vc postou?? sem o risco no meio das letras claro rs,rs,?? , mais uma vez obrigado!! abçs Bruxo
Título: Re:Troca de Ferramenta
Enviado por: Bruxo em 15 de Abril de 2011, 19:34
Alebe ,,   acho que deu certo rs,rs, coloquei as linhas que vc postou, e não deu mais o erro, mas me diz uma coisa, ou melhor me confirme, o M9 liga o refrigerante  o M5 desliga a ferramenta, o M6 é a troca da ferramenta, onde o programa vai parar p/ troca, o M3 é rotação direita,, o M7 não sei o que é, o M8 desliga o refrigerante, é isso mesmo?? to perguntando porque como uso tupia, e tenho que ligar manual,,,,,(uso uma placa Phase Drive,, é boa mas é limitada em certas coisas,,, sendo assim,, posso eliminar algumas  linhas,, o que acha?? abçs Bruxo
Título: Re:Troca de Ferramenta
Enviado por: Alebe em 15 de Abril de 2011, 20:31
Aqui tem os comandos com descrição:

TOOLCHANGE = "(Desliga a refrigeracao/aspiracao)"
TOOLCHANGE = "M9"
TOOLCHANGE = "(Move o eixo de Z Para a posicao de troca)"
TOOLCHANGE = "G0Z50.0000"
TOOLCHANGE = "(Desliga a Tupia/Dremel)"
TOOLCHANGE = "M5"
TOOLCHANGE = "(Numero da ferramenta)"
TOOLCHANGE = "T2"
TOOLCHANGE = "(Pede a troca da ferramenta)"
TOOLCHANGE = "M6"
TOOLCHANGE = "(Liga a Tupia/Dremel)"
TOOLCHANGE = "M3 [ S ]"
TOOLCHANGE = "(Liga a refrigeracao/aspiracao)"
TOOLCHANGE = "M7"
TOOLCHANGE = "M8"
TOOLCHANGE = "(Coloca a taxa de avanco em marcha lenta)"
TOOLCHANGE = "F360"
Título: Re:Troca de Ferramenta
Enviado por: Bruxo em 15 de Abril de 2011, 20:49
Muito obrigado Alebe,,  mas uma vez,, so aprendi com o pessoal do forum,,,  muito obrigado mesmo!!!,,, meu próximo passo sera um joystick  no emc 2 rs,rs, abçs,, Bruxo
Ps:: vc vai no encontro do Guia Cnc?
Título: Re:Troca de Ferramenta
Enviado por: Alebe em 15 de Abril de 2011, 22:41
Ps:: vc vai no encontro do Guia Cnc?

Infelizmente, não.  :'(
Título: Re:Troca de Ferramenta
Enviado por: mulapreta em 16 de Abril de 2011, 01:57
Alebe,


Teste do S meu amigo sinto muito pelos seus Sss


Os teclados são: [+S+] para início dda fraze riscada e [+/S+] para finalizar o riscado.

Como você viu, tambem acontece o mesmo aqui e em todos os computadores que postarem no forum.

Digite uma paravra qualquer, depois selecione essa palavra e mude o formato do caracteres oara "cortado" opção acima, junto com B (bold) I (itálico) e U (sublinhado).

Você vera que aparecerá o [+S+] antes e [+/S+] depois da referida palavra. Acontece que como fazemos com o "quote", colocamos via teclado o riscado, só que voce coloca o sinal do S antes das palavras e não coloca outro apos as palavras, então tudo que escreve sairá riscado por não ter o "Stop" [+/S+].

Não sei se me fiz entender. Realmente é complicado explicar isso por escrito.

Abraços

Edson

Título: Re:Troca de Ferramenta
Enviado por: Alebe em 16 de Abril de 2011, 08:39
Não sei se me fiz entender. Realmente é complicado explicar isso por escrito.

Oi Edson, tudo bem?
Precisei ler o texto todo umas 3X, mas consegui entender sim.  hehehe
Continua então sem solução pros meus ssss. ;D
Um grande abraço
Alebe
Título: Re:Troca de Ferramenta
Enviado por: Guia CNC em 16 de Abril de 2011, 09:20
Este "problema" ocorre por causa do html que o sistema do fórum aceita.


Eu ate consigo desabilitar, mais ai os links e videos postados perdem a referencia e faz caca no fórum inteiro.


Uma solução é colocar o [ s] com um espaço entre o colchetes e a letra S.


Ou colocar ["s"] e depois avisa para tirar as aspas e/ou espaço. vou ver se tem algum modulo para isso, igual o usado no wordpress.



Título: Re:Troca de Ferramenta
Enviado por: Alebe em 16 de Abril de 2011, 15:17
Jost,
Na verdade eu já tinha arrumado uma solução, que é enviar o texto que contenha os ["s"]  anexado num arquivo texto.
Acho que não é necessário vc se preocupar com isso. Muito trampo pra pouco retorno.  ;)

Título: Re:Troca de Ferramenta
Enviado por: Bruxo em 02 de Maio de 2011, 15:52
Ola pessoal,,olha eu novamente rs, pessoal,,,, so hoje tive a oportunidade de testar um arquivo com troca de ferramenta gerada no Artcam e com as modificações que o Alebe  postou,,, no art cam,, não deu erro ,,  mas na prática,,, deu!!,, assim: gerei o código,  ferramenta 1, ferramenta 2, mas no emc, quando fui cortar, simplesmente  o programa não parou p/ troca, mesmo tendo o M6, T2 tipo,  mudou a linha e foi embora , não entendi nada! tem algum codigo que preciso colocar no cabeçalho p/ que o emc entenda que vai ter a troca? o M6 ja não é o suficiente? abçs  Bruxo
Título: Re:Troca de Ferramenta
Enviado por: F.Gilii em 02 de Maio de 2011, 15:57
Só M6 não adianta nada - é preciso dizer4 que ferramenta quer e claro, o programa deve estar preparado para parar quando encontrar o comando de troca.

Sei fazer isso no Mach3, mas não no EMC
Título: Re:Troca de Ferramenta
Enviado por: Alebe em 02 de Maio de 2011, 16:34
Bruxo,
Anexe o gcode pra darmos uma olhada.
Título: Re:Troca de Ferramenta
Enviado por: Bruxo em 02 de Maio de 2011, 17:01
Desde ja agradeço pela ajuda,,,  Sr Gilii,, acredito que seja o que comentou,,, mas não sei como fazer,, Alebe,,, isso foi o que acrescentei no pos processador ok,, to anexando o código gerado pelo art cam

; Toolchange Sections
;
TOOLCHANGE = "M9"
TOOLCHANGE = "G0Z50.0000"
TOOLCHANGE = "M5"
TOOLCHANGE = "T2"
TOOLCHANGE = "M6"
TOOLCHANGE = "M3 "
TOOLCHANGE = "M7"
TOOLCHANGE = "M8"
TOOLCHANGE = "F360"
;
 
 agora o código gerado:

(teste troca de ferramenta)
 
(Dados do material em mm:)
( X Tam:230.000  Y Tam:350.000  Z Tam:3.000)
 
( Ferramenta )
(1.500 mm diâm. da ferr. topo)
 
 (Velocidade de avanço :1500)
 (Velocidade de descida:800)
 (Velocidade de corte  :9999)
 
(teste troca de ferramenta)
 
g64 P0.2
g04 P2
G01 X0. Y0. Z-3. F800
G01 Z10. F800
N18 G00 X52.034 Y109.096 Z5.000
N19 G01 X52.034 Y109.096 Z-3.000 F800.0
N20 G02 X52.950 Y116.350 I29.107 J0.008 F1500.0
N21 G02 X61.550 Y130.578 I28.089 J-7.264
N22 G02 X79.576 Y138.076 I19.473 J-21.400
N23 G02 X86.918 Y137.521 I1.486 J-29.214
N24 G02 X101.591 Y129.605 I-5.839 J-28.377
N25 G02 X110.086 Y109.078 I-20.467 J-20.492
N26 G02 X109.170 Y101.824 I-29.082 J-0.011
N27 G02 X100.570 Y87.596 I-28.089 J7.264
N28 G02 X82.544 Y80.098 I-19.473 J21.400
N29 G02 X75.202 Y80.653 I-1.486 J29.214
N30 G02 X60.529 Y88.569 I5.839 J28.377
N31 G02 X52.034 Y109.078 I20.467 J20.492
N32 G01 X52.034 Y109.096 Z-3.000
N33 G00 X52.034 Y109.096 Z5.000
M9
G0Z50.0000
M5
T2
M6
M3
F360
N41 G00 X13.828 Y89.325 Z5.000
N42 G01 X13.828 Y89.325 Z-3.000 F800.0
N43 G02 X15.641 Y105.316 I71.154 J0.030 F1600.0
N44 G02 X37.055 Y141.802 I69.036 J-15.990
N45 G02 X81.089 Y160.142 I47.605 J-52.268
N46 G02 X110.744 Y155.319 I3.697 J-70.859
N47 G02 X149.401 Y118.511 I-26.126 J-66.142
N48 G02 X155.649 Y87.495 I-64.525 J-29.135
abçs Bruxo
Título: Re:Troca de Ferramenta
Enviado por: Alebe em 02 de Maio de 2011, 21:36
Bruxo,
O gcode está correto. Aqui funfou certinho.
O que deve estar acontecendo é que o arquivo .tbl não esta sendo carregado na sua configuração.
Da pra saber se foi carregado quando se abre o emc, uma outra janela abre junto e fecha sozinha em alguns segundos.
Se vc estiver usando algumas daquelas opções de configurações pre definidas pelo emc, isto pode acontecer.
Algumas delas não carregam o arquivo de ferramenta.
Procure criar uma configuração pelo Step Config e verifique que na tela "Basics Machine Information" a opção "onscreen prompt for tool change" esteja selecionada.
Título: Re:Troca de Ferramenta
Enviado por: Bruxo em 03 de Maio de 2011, 17:00
Alebe, vou verificar isso  ok,,,,,, mas a versão que to usando acredito que não tenha isso,,,,, to usando o ubutun 8.10 e a versão do emc é 2.2 alguma coisa rs,rs,,,,, olha,,,,,  na outra msg que postei com o codigo G,,, fiz uma modificação,, fiz o seguinte: depois da linha G0 Z 50. acrescentei o M00 isso fez com o que o programa pare,, ai se troca a ferramenta, e starto novamente,, funcionou,, sei que não é o certo, mas não sei fazer da maneira correta,, o importante que funcionou rs,rs  PS: mas testei no simulador,,,, ainda não testei no emc,,, amanha testo e posto o resultado, ok,,,  mais uma vez, muito obrigado!! abçs Bruxo
Título: Re:Troca de Ferramenta
Enviado por: Hector Roman em 19 de Agosto de 2011, 18:42
Ola amigos, estou começando no mundo do CNC e estou acompanhando seus comentarios sob troca de ferramentas, para aprender alguma coisa ja que sou leigo em quasse tudo.
Espero postem o final da busca da troca de ferramenta no artcam corretamente.
Obrigado por tudo
Hector